How Much Does Laptop Screen Repair Cost?

If you're in need of laptop screen repair, you're probably wondering how much it will cost you. The answer, unfortunately, depends on a variety of factors.

1. What factors affect the cost of laptop screen repair?

There are many factors that can affect the cost of laptop screen repair. The type of laptop, the size of the screen, and the level of damage all play a role in how much the repair will cost. Generally, the more expensive the laptop, the more expensive the repair will be. Larger screens also tend to be more expensive to repair. And finally, the more damage that has been done to the screen, the more expensive the repair will be.

2. How much does laptop screen repair usually cost?

There is no one definitive answer to this question as the cost of laptop screen repair can vary depending on a number of factors, including the make and model of the laptop, the extent of the damage, and the technician's hourly rate. However, in general, the cost of repairing a laptop screen tends to be relatively affordable, with most repairs costing between Rs.1500 and Rs.5000.

3. What are some tips for reducing the cost of laptop screen repair?

If your laptop screen is cracked or damaged, you may be wondering how much it will cost to repair. Depending on the severity of the damage, the cost of a screen repair can vary. However, there are a few tips you can follow to help reduce the cost of a laptop screen repair.

First, try to find a reputable laptop screen repair shop. It's important to choose a shop that has a lot of experience repairing laptop screens and that uses high-quality parts. This will help ensure that the repair is done correctly and that the screen lasts for a long time.

Second, be sure to get a quote before you have the repair done. This will give you an idea of how much the repair will cost and will help you compare prices between different shops.

Finally, try to do some of the work yourself. There are a number of helpful tutorials online that can show you how to replace a laptop screen. This can save you a lot of money on the cost of a repair.
